Ordinals
beta
Address 3JenEfqgDWBVUV5cLhPM3usZKFByAgw7Do
sat balance
10034010
outputs
bbc3799bd3a2d45a7dbb93ee2455fc925966657b0e3ca26dd39d86d891c7394e:1